摘要:探讨了用范氏法测定植物中酸性洗涤木质素(ADL)的影响因素,对不同消煮时间、不同硫酸浓度、不同浸泡时间条件下的测定结果进行了比较分析。结果表明:样品消煮的适宜时间为30 min,硫酸适宜浓度为72%~75%,浸泡适宜时间为3~4 h;人工检测结果的变异系数(CV)在2.23%~6.66%之间,仪器法的CV在0.15%~1.10%之间;人工检测与仪器法所测结果无显著性差异;范氏法与王玉万法所测结果无显著性差异,这两种方法适用于植物ADL的测定。
The author explored the factors affecting the determination of plant acid detergent lignin(ADL) by using Van Soest method, and compared and analyzed the determination results under different conditions. The results showed that: the suitable time for sample boiling was 30 min;the suitable concentration of sulfuric acid for sample decomposition was 72%~75%;the appropriate time for sample soaking was 3~4 h;the coefficient of variation(CV) of manual determination results was 2.23%~6.66%, while the CV of instrument determination results was 0.15%~1.10%;there was no significant difference in determination results between manual method and instrument method;there was also no significant difference in determination results between Van Soest method and Wang Yuwan’s method, and these two methods were all suitable for the determination of plant ADL.
